Fish Tacos with Spicy Slaw


You will need:

medium bowl  |  large shallow dish  |  frying pan


Ingredients:


Slaw:

  • 3 limes

  • ¾ C Soy-free mayonnaise 

  • 1-1.5 tsp chipotle chili powder

  • 1 tsp minced garlic or ¼ tsp garlic powder

  • 1 bag coleslaw


Optional:

  • Sliced green onions


Fish

  • 1 lb tilapia filets

  • ⅓ cup flour

  • 1 tsp chipotle chili powder 

  • ½ tsp salt

  • 2 Tbsp canola oil for frying


Tortillas

  • 8 Tortilla Fresca Uncooked Flour Tortillas


Directions:

  1. In a medium bowl, add mayonnaise, chipotle powder, and garlic. Zest and juice limes, stir all ingredients together. Add coleslaw and mix to combine.

  2. In a large frying pan or skillet, heat canola oil over medium heat.

  3. In a large shallow dish (such as a pie plate) combine flour, chipotle powder, and salt. Coat tilapia filets on all sides.

  4. Fry tilapia on both sides until golden brown on the outside and flaky inside.

  5. Meanwhile, cook tortillas according to package directions.

  6. When tilapia and tortillas are ready, assemble your tacos! Using a fork, break up the fish into bite sized pieces. Put them on the tortilla, top with slaw and green onions.
